.compare_buttons{font-weight:400;font-size:12px;line-height:130%;padding:20px 0 5px 15px;transition:all .3s ease-in}.compare_buttons p{cursor:pointer;padding:5px}.compare_buttons--add{color:#a8a8a8}.compare_buttons--remove{color:#595959;background:#f0eff2}.product__content{display:flex;position:relative;max-width:1366px;margin:0 auto}.product__right{display:block}.product__video{position:fixed;bottom:0;left:0;height:85vh;right:0;display:flex;justify-content:center;align-items:center;z-index:3;background:rgba(255,255,255,.95);transition:transform .3s ease-in-out}.product__video__closed{transform:translateY(100%)}.product__video__close{display:flex;justify-content:flex-end;max-width:90%;position:absolute;right:45px;top:0;cursor:pointer}.product__video__iframe{max-width:864px;max-height:486px;width:70%;height:95%}.product__left{flex:65%;max-width:65%;background:#fff}.product__left__seals{position:absolute;bottom:12%;display:flex;flex-direction:column;z-index:1;gap:8px}.product__left__seals__type{opacity:0;visibility:hidden;transition:all .3s ease-in;padding:6px 12px;display:flex;align-items:center;justify-content:center;margin-left:-10px;z-index:-1;max-height:28px;background:#a7f860}.product__left__seals__text{font-weight:700;font-size:12px;line-height:130%;letter-spacing:.1em;color:#090808}.product__left__seals__item{display:flex;cursor:pointer;align-items:center}.product__left__seals__item:hover .product__left__seals__type{opacity:1;visibility:visible}.product__left__gallery{margin:0 auto;position:relative;padding:20px 40px 0}.product__left__gallery__figure{margin:0;position:relative;height:400px}.product__left__gallery__figure.zoom{height:500px}.product__left__gallery__container{margin-top:40px}.product__left__gallery__content{max-height:390px}.product__left__gallery__content.zoom{max-height:500px}.product__left__gallery__buttons{position:absolute;z-index:0;top:0;bottom:0;display:flex;justify-content:space-between;align-items:center;left:0;right:0;margin:auto;transition:all .3s ease-in-out}.product__left__gallery__buttons .prev,.product__left__gallery__buttons .next{z-index:1;cursor:pointer}.product__left__gallery__image{margin:0 auto;object-fit:contain;position:absolute;left:0;right:0;top:0;bottom:0}.product__left__gallery__image.zoom{transform:scale(2)}.product__left__thumbs{display:flex;align-items:center;justify-content:center;position:relative;margin-top:10px;gap:14px}.product__left__thumbs__counter{transition:all .5s ease-in-out}.product__left__thumbs__count{display:flex;align-items:center;font-size:14px;color:#a8a8a8}.product__left__thumbs__count--current{line-height:18px;font-weight:700;color:#a7f860}.product__left__thumbs__content{transition:all .3s ease-in-out}.product__left__thumbs__content.slick-slide figure{display:flex;width:fit-content;margin:0 auto;transition:all .3s ease-in;border:2px solid rgba(0,0,0,0)}.product__left__thumbs__content.slick-current figure{border-color:#a7f860}.product__left__thumbs__item{padding-inline:5px}.product__left__thumbs__container{min-width:0;flex:1;max-width:320px;transition:all .5s ease-in-out}.product__left__thumbs__image{padding:5px}.product__left__zoom{position:absolute;right:0;z-index:2;padding:5px 10px;transition:all .5s ease-in-out}.product__left__zoom.floating{transform:translateY(-40px);background:rgba(255,255,255,.75)}.product__left__zoom__content{display:flex;align-items:center;gap:10px;transition:all .5s ease-in-out}.product__left__zoom__text{font-weight:400;font-size:12px;line-height:130%;color:#a8a8a8}.product__left__diferencials{display:flex;flex-direction:column;gap:40px;margin-top:110px}.product__left__diferencials__title{font-weight:700;font-size:24px;line-height:130%;color:#090808;padding-left:50px}.product__left__diferencials ul{display:flex;flex-direction:column;gap:40px;max-width:100%}.product__left__diferencials li{display:flex;justify-content:space-between}.product__left__diferencials li div{display:flex;flex-direction:column;justify-content:center;gap:24px;padding:50px;font-weight:400;font-size:18px;line-height:150%;color:#343434}.product__left__diferencials li div br{display:none}.product__left__diferencials li div span{font-weight:700;font-size:24px;line-height:130%;color:#131313}.product__left__diferencials li:nth-child(even){flex-direction:row-reverse}.product__left__diferencials img{object-fit:contain;width:443px;max-width:100%;max-height:320px}.product__left__desc{padding-inline:50px;display:flex;flex-direction:column;gap:40px;margin-top:70px;color:#090808}.product__left__desc__title{font-weight:700;font-size:24px;line-height:130%}.product__left__desc__content{display:flex;max-height:414px;justify-content:space-between}.product__left__desc__content p{font-weight:400;font-size:14px;line-height:21px;display:block;margin:20px 0;color:#595959}.product__left__desc__content strong{font-weight:700;font-size:18px;line-height:23px;display:block}.product__left__desc__left{max-width:55%;max-height:100%;overflow-y:auto;padding-right:25px}.product__left__desc__left::-webkit-scrollbar-track{background:#ebeef1;border-radius:6px}.product__left__desc__left::-webkit-scrollbar-thumb{background:#a8a8a8;border-radius:6px}.product__left__desc__right{width:fit-content;display:flex;flex-direction:column;gap:8px;overflow-y:auto}.product__left__desc__right img{object-fit:scale-down;max-width:316px;max-height:252px}.product__left__desc__right::-webkit-scrollbar{display:none}.product__left__especs{padding-inline:50px;display:flex;flex-direction:column;gap:40px;margin-top:90px;margin-bottom:80px}.product__left__especs__title{font-weight:700;font-size:24px;line-height:130%}.product__left__especs__content table{width:100%}.product__left__especs__content td{font-weight:400;font-size:14px;line-height:150%;padding-block:8px}.product__left__especs__content td:nth-child(even){color:#090808;padding-inline:0 34px;flex:2.5}.product__left__especs__content td:nth-child(odd){color:#595959;padding-inline:34px;flex:1}.product__left__especs__content tr{display:flex;align-items:center;justify-content:space-between}.product__left__especs__content tr:nth-child(odd){background:#ebeef1}.product__left__avaliation{padding-inline:50px}.product__left__avaliation__title{font-weight:700;font-size:24px;line-height:130%}.product__left__related{padding:0 50px 10px}.product__left__related__top{display:flex;align-items:center;justify-content:space-between}.product__left__related__buttons{display:flex;justify-content:space-between;align-items:center;position:absolute;gap:40px;top:40%;width:100%}.product__left__related__buttons .prev,.product__left__related__buttons .next{z-index:1;cursor:pointer;transition:all .3s ease-in}.product__left__related__buttons .prev:hover,.product__left__related__buttons .next:hover{background:#a7f860}.product__left__related__buttons .prev:hover path,.product__left__related__buttons .next:hover path{stroke:#fff}.product__left__related__buttons .prev path,.product__left__related__buttons .next path{transition:all .3s ease-in}.product__left__related__title{font-weight:300;font-size:16px;line-height:150%;letter-spacing:.5em;text-transform:uppercase;color:#090808}.product__left__related__container{display:flex;flex-direction:column;gap:40px;position:relative}.product__left__related__content{flex:1 auto;min-width:0}.product__left__related__content .related__comparator{font-weight:400;font-size:12px;line-height:130%;padding:20px 0 5px 15px;transition:all .3s ease-in}.product__left__related__content .related__comparator p{padding:5px;cursor:pointer}.product__left__related__content .related__comparator--add{color:#a8a8a8}.product__left__related__content .related__comparator--remove{color:#595959;background:#f0eff2}.product__left__related__content .related__item{background:#fff;padding:0 10px 20px 10px;border:1px solid rgba(0,0,0,0);position:relative;transition:all .3s ease-in}.product__left__related__content .related__item__seals{position:absolute;top:20px;right:13px;display:flex;flex-direction:column;z-index:1;transition:all .5s ease-in-out}.product__left__related__content .related__item__seals__type{opacity:0;visibility:hidden;transition:all .3s ease-in;padding:12px 6px;display:flex;transform:scaleY(-1) scaleX(-1);align-items:center;justify-content:center;z-index:-1;-webkit-writing-mode:vertical-rl;margin-top:-10px}.product__left__related__content .related__item__seals__text{font-weight:700;font-size:12px;line-height:130%;letter-spacing:.1em;color:#090808}.product__left__related__content .related__item__seals__item{display:flex;flex-direction:column;cursor:pointer;align-items:center}.product__left__related__content .related__item__seals__item:hover .related__item__seals__type{opacity:1;visibility:visible}.product__left__related__content .related__item__figure{max-width:294px;max-height:251px}.product__left__related__content .related__item__image{object-fit:contain;max-width:100%}.product__left__related__content .related__item__info{display:flex;flex-direction:column;gap:10px;transform:translateY(30px);transition:transform .3s ease-in}.product__left__related__content .related__item__info--main{display:flex;flex-direction:column;gap:4px}.product__left__related__content .related__item__hidden{opacity:0;visibility:hidden;display:flex;flex-direction:column;gap:10px;transition:all .3s ease-in}.product__left__related__content .related__item__flags{height:26px;display:flex;gap:5px}.product__left__related__content .related__item__flag{padding:5px;font-size:12px}.product__left__related__content .related__item__flag__featured{color:#343434;font-weight:400;border:1px solid #131313}.product__left__related__content .related__item__flag__released{font-weight:700;color:#fff;background:#090808}.product__left__related__content .related__item__name{font-weight:400;font-size:14px;line-height:150%;color:#343434;height:42px;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.product__left__related__content .related__item__bottom{display:flex;flex-direction:column;padding:0 10px;gap:24px}.product__left__related__content .related__item__price{font-weight:700;font-size:18px;line-height:130%;color:#090808}.product__left__related__content .related__item__button{background:#a7f860;padding:12px 0;width:100%;display:flex;align-items:center;justify-content:center;font-weight:700;font-size:14px;line-height:20px;color:#000;transition:all .5s ease-in}.product__left__related__content .related__item__button:hover{background-color:#6edd0d}.product__left__related__content .related__item:hover{border-color:#a7f860}.product__left__related__content .related__item:hover .related__item__hidden{opacity:1;visibility:visible}.product__left__related__content .related__item:hover .related__item__info{transform:translateY(0px)}.product__right{flex:35%}.product__right__content{padding:40px 50px;display:flex;flex-direction:column;gap:24px;position:sticky;top:60px}.product__right__avaliation{display:flex;align-items:center;gap:8px}.product__right__avaliation a{font-weight:400;font-size:14px;color:#fff}.product__right__top{display:flex;justify-content:space-between;gap:5px;flex-flow:wrap-reverse}.product__right__info{display:flex;flex-direction:column;gap:16px}.product__right__prices--main{font-weight:700;font-size:24px;line-height:130%;color:#a7f860}.product__right__quantity{display:flex;align-items:center;background:#131313;width:fit-content;padding:10px 12px;border-radius:1px}.product__right__quantity button,.product__right__quantity input{background:none;outline:none;border:none;display:flex;align-items:center}.product__right__quantity input{text-align:center;width:45px;font-weight:600;font-size:16px;line-height:130%;letter-spacing:-0.002em;color:#fff}.product__right__ref{font-weight:400;font-size:14px;line-height:150%;color:#595959}.product__right__buy{font-weight:700;font-size:14px;line-height:20px;display:flex;align-items:center;justify-content:center;font-feature-settings:"tnum" on,"lnum" on;color:#000;background:#a7f860;padding:12px 0}.product__right__name{font-family:"Termina";font-weight:800;font-size:24px;line-height:130%;color:#fff}.product__right__downloads,.product__right__downloads__list{display:flex;flex-direction:column}.product__right__downloads{gap:32px}.product__right__downloads__title{font-weight:700;font-size:16px;line-height:130%;color:#fff}.product__right__downloads__list{gap:20px;max-height:100px;overflow-x:auto}.product__right__downloads__link{font-weight:400;font-size:14px;line-height:150%;display:flex;align-items:center;gap:10px;color:#fff}.product .comments__form--comment{margin-block:0 24px}.product .comments__form--comment>textarea{resize:none;border:1px solid #ebeef1;padding:16px 28px;font-weight:400;font-size:14px;line-height:150%;width:100%;height:181px;max-width:100%;color:#3b384d}.product .comments__form--author input,.product .comments__form--email input{width:100%;height:50px;padding:16px 18px;font-weight:400;font-size:14px;line-height:150%;border:1px solid #ebeef1;color:#3b384d}.product .comments__form--author{margin-bottom:12px}.product .comments__form--submit{width:133px;height:42px;border:1px solid #090808;font-weight:700;font-size:14px;line-height:130%;text-align:center;color:#090808;background:#fff;margin-block:0 50px}.product .comments__form--rating{display:flex;flex-wrap:wrap;gap:24px 28px;align-items:center;margin-block:0 24px}.product .comments__form--rating label{font-weight:400;font-size:14px;line-height:150%;color:#090808}.product .comments__form--rating .stars{display:flex;align-items:center;height:fit-content}.product .comments__form--rating .stars span{display:flex;gap:5px}.product .comments__form--rating .stars span a{position:relative;font-size:0}.product .comments__form--rating .stars span a:after{display:block;content:"";width:16px;height:16px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='15' fill='none'%3E%3Cpath fill='%23fff' stroke='%23A8A8A8' d='M8 1.302 9.654 5.28l.118.282.304.024 4.294.344L11.1 8.733l-.232.198.07.297 1 4.19-3.676-2.245L8 11.014l-.26.16-3.677 2.245 1-4.19.07-.298-.232-.198L1.63 5.93l4.294-.344.304-.024.118-.282L8 1.302Z'/%3E%3C/svg%3E")}.product .comments__form--title{flex:100%;font-weight:700;font-size:18px;line-height:130%;color:#000}.product .comments__form--counter{font-weight:400;font-size:14px;line-height:150%;color:#595959}.product .comments .acf-fields .acf-label{margin:0}.product .comments .acf-fields .acf-label>label{font-weight:700;font-size:18px;line-height:130%;color:#000;margin:0}.product .comments .acf-fields [data-name=cidade] .acf-label,.product .comments .acf-fields [data-name=estado] .acf-label{display:none}.product .comments .acf-fields [data-type=date_picker]{display:none}.product .comments .acf-fields .acf-field.acf-field-radio{display:flex;flex-direction:column;gap:24px;margin-block:0 24px}.product .comments .acf-input input[type=text]{width:100%;height:50px;padding:16px 18px;font-weight:400;font-size:14px;line-height:150%;border:1px solid #ebeef1;color:#3b384d;max-width:100%}.product .comments .acf-input input[type=radio]{appearance:none;display:flex;width:16px;height:16px;border-radius:50%;border:1px solid #343434;align-items:center;justify-content:center;margin:0}.product .comments .acf-input input[type=radio]:checked:before{content:"";width:8px;height:8px;margin:auto;background:#a7f860;border-radius:50%}.product .comments .acf-input .acf-radio-list{display:flex;flex-direction:column;gap:12px}.product .comments .acf-input .acf-radio-list:after,.product .comments .acf-input .acf-radio-list:before{display:none}.product .comments .acf-input li label{display:flex;gap:16px;align-items:center}.product .comments .logged-in-as{display:none}.product .comments .comment-form-cookies-consent{display:flex;align-items:baseline;gap:8px;margin-block:16px 32px}.product .comments .comment-form-cookies-consent label{font-weight:400;font-size:12px;color:#090808;place-self:center}.product .comments .comment-form-cookies-consent input{appearance:none;height:16px;width:16px;background:#ebeef1;border-radius:50%;vertical-align:middle}.product .comments .comment-form-cookies-consent input:checked{background:#a7f860;position:relative}.product .comments .comment-form-cookies-consent input:checked:before{content:"";position:absolute;top:0;bottom:0;right:0;left:0;display:block;margin:auto;width:14px;height:10px;background-image:url("data:image/svg+xml,%3Csvg width='14' height='10' viewBox='0 0 14 10'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M12 2L4.99998 9.00002L1.99994 6' stroke='%23131313' stroke-width='1.5' stroke-linecap='square' stroke-linejoin='round'/%3E%3C/svg%3E%0A")}.product .comments__body{display:flex;flex-direction:column;gap:21px;padding-bottom:30px}.product .comments__content{display:flex;flex-direction:column;gap:12px}.product .comments_middle__content{display:flex;gap:50px}.product .comments__item{position:relative}.product .comments__item--top{display:flex;align-items:center;justify-content:space-between}.product .comments__item--middle{display:flex;flex-direction:column;gap:12px}.product .comments__item--bottom{display:flex;gap:50px}.product .comments__item:after{content:"";height:1px;background:#eaebea;display:block;position:absolute;width:100%;left:0;right:0}.product .comments__list{display:flex;flex-direction:column;gap:30px}.product .comments__author,.product .comments__from{font-weight:400;font-size:14px;display:flex;line-height:150%;color:#090808;gap:8px}.product .comments__author strong,.product .comments__from strong{font-weight:700;line-height:130%}.product .comments__date{font-weight:400;font-size:14px;line-height:150%;color:#090808}.product .comments__text{font-weight:400;font-size:14px;line-height:150%;color:#090808}.product .comments__sex,.product .comments__expectation{font-size:14px;color:#090808}.product .comments__sex--title,.product .comments__expectation--title{font-weight:700;line-height:130%}.product .comments__sex--text,.product .comments__expectation--text{line-height:150%}.product .comments .comment-reply-title{font-weight:700;font-size:14px;line-height:130%;color:#090808;border:1px solid #090808;width:fit-content;padding:12px 15px;margin-block:30px;cursor:pointer}@media(max-width: 991px){.related__item__figure{margin:0 auto}.product .comments_middle__content{flex-wrap:wrap;gap:12px}.product .comments__item--bottom{flex-wrap:wrap;gap:12px}}@media(max-width: 767px){.product__left__gallery__image{width:100%}.product__right{display:none}.product__left{max-width:100%}.product__left__related{padding:50px 36px 10px}.product__left__diferencials{align-items:center;max-width:95%;margin:34px auto 0}.product__left__diferencials li{display:block;justify-content:left}.product__left__diferencials li div{padding:20px 50px;max-width:450px}.product__left__diferencials__title{padding-left:0}.product__left__thumbs__container,.product__left__thumbs__counter{display:none}.product__left__gallery .slick-dots li button{height:4px;width:32px;font-size:0;background-color:#ccc;margin:0 5px}.product__left__gallery .slick-active button{background-color:#16c73f !important;margin:0 5px}.product__left__zoom{position:relative}.product__left__especs{padding-inline:20px}.product table,.product tbody{display:block}.product td:nth-child(odd){text-align:center;word-break:break-word;padding-inline:15px}.product td:nth-child(even){padding-inline:15px;flex:1}.mobile__product__right{display:block;background-color:#090808}.mobile__product__right p{font-size:20px}.breadcrumb .woocommerce-breadcrumb{display:block !important}.slick-dots{display:flex;justify-content:center}}